It is the main topic to study the relationship between protein sequence and structure in molecular biology. Although researchers have been made huge success in the study of protein in the half of a century,there still have some basic problems unrevealed, such as whether protein sequences are random chains or not, and how to predict the secondary and tertiary structures of proteins directly from their amino acid sequences, and so on. So, it is a meaningful task to study the relationship between protein sequence and structure. Firstly, we analyze the distribution of the components of amino acids of protein sequence and find that the probabilities of the 20 kinds of amino acids are not equal. We also find there is large difference between the number of known protein sequence and that of random sequences which made up randomly by 20 kinds of amino acids. All these revealed that the protein sequence is not uniform randomness in some extent. In order to demonstrate our conclusion further, we bring forward nonlinear prediction method to study protein sequence. We apply nonlinear prediction method to all alpha proteins, all beta proteins and Tim-barrel proteins and find that there exists nonlinear correlation between protein sequences and their structures. It is showed that most proteins contain certain length correlation segments only if its three-dimension structure is symmetric, and the length of these correlation segments is also corresponding to the length of these symmetrical regions. For finding out the essence of the correlation between protein sequences and the symmetry of their structures, we use the modified nonlinear prediction method and recurrent plot method to the beta-trefoil family proteins whose structures contain perfect three-fold symmetry. The results show that these protein sequences also contain hidden three-fold symmetry and the hidden symmetry is corresponding to their structural three-fold symmetry. So we believe that their structural symmetry is possibly coded by their sequence hidden symmetry. In summary, we studied the relationship of protein sequence and structure. The results not only reveal part of the relations between symmetries of sequences and symmetries of structures of proteins, but also show that the nonlinear correlation method may provide a new approach to detect the essential characters and inherent rules of protein sequences.
